Editorial Review for Eating Establishment – by Kristen Gould Case
The Scene
Two brick rooms feature sandstone-colored stucco walls, tile floors, fireplaces and photographs of southern Utah. Though it's open for lunch and dinner, it's breakfast that this classic spot is known for. Recovering partiers come to hangover central for stick-to-your-ribs breakfasts that are served until late afternoon.
The Food
In addition to breakfast, burgers, club sandwiches, fish and chips, grilled cheese and salads are offered for lunch. For dinner, there are barbecue specialties, salads, steak, trout, halibut and pastas. There's also a great kids' menu available. If you're looking for a real gut-buster, try the Hungry Miner with seasoned potatoes, melted cheddar cheese topped with basted eggs and onion, ham, green pepper and mushrooms. Other rib stickers include huevos rancheros; corned beef hash and eggs; or biscuits and gravy. The delicious Park City omelette is stuffed with avocado, mushroom, tomato, onion and melted jack cheese and sprouts.

Insider Tips
Save TimeOn weekends in winter, the line sometimes goes out the door, but you won't wait long for a table.
Know Before You GoDon't have a dining partner? With windows right on Main Street and newspapers all over the joint, the EE is a good place to hang out on a lazy day, read and people watch.
